Output 31b847fadc698ff1bf843fe9f6b3f478e7270119a506445baeb0ef62ece1da10:0

value
164584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1fd1920160aca822ed73a33bcccd87e644196cc OP_EQUAL
address
3LqLMCmmgi459tVKAGC4iqvyWBp7TkDaGy
transaction
31b847fadc698ff1bf843fe9f6b3f478e7270119a506445baeb0ef62ece1da10
confirmations
131573
spent
true